In Rockstar's GTA series, there used to be a six-star wanted level, which was reduced to five stars in GTA V. Now, Rockstar is returning to its roots by reintroducing the six-star wanted level in GTA 6.
This has been confirmed in the GTA 6 gameplay demo released today on Netflix. Although it's unclear what heinous acts Jason and Lucia committed to attract such a massive police presence, it's clear that the overwhelming number of officers won't let them off easily. Icons shown in the GTA 6 trailer also suggest that the game will feature indicators for specific crimes committed by the player. While full details are not yet available, it is entirely logical that Rockstar will improve the wanted system in some form.
For example, when Jason or Lucia hides a car in the garage, one of the icons—the car—will disappear. Additionally, players can destroy surveillance camera footage to evade police pursuit. However, if you choose to confront them head-on with aggressive actions, such as storming an area with a gun, the police will respond with greater force.
